Ocala Home Seller's Electrical Checklist: What to Expect
Preparing your Ocala property for listing involves a careful inspection of its electrical wiring. Buyers and professionals will scrutinize these areas, so it’s vital to address potential issues proactively. Expect a thorough evaluation into grounding , outlet functionality (ensuring they are properly connected), and the condition of your electrical box. A licensed electrician might be needed to repair older or faulty components. Don’t miss smoke and carbon monoxide detectors ; they must be present and have new batteries. Finally, be ready to share documentation of any prior electrical work that's been performed . Addressing these points will increase your property’s appeal and help ease the transaction process.
